Chelsea Agree Deal For Willian Subject To Medical

23 August 2013 20:07

Chelsea have agreed a 30 million deal to sign attacking midfielder Willian from Russian club Anzhi Makhachkala subject to a work permit hearing according to BBC Sport

Chelsea moved late to secure the services of the Brazilian after Tottenham believed the deal was close after the successful completion of a medical. However, Russian owner Roman Abramovich made a late call to the Anzhi owner and tabled a last minute offer greater than that of the North London club.

News of a potential switch to the Blues was all but confirmed by the chelsea manager in a press conference earlier afternoon. Asked whether the Brazilian had chosen to join his club, Mourinho nodded. The Portuguese added: "I know what the player wants, so in this moment we cannot hide. That is a possibility." It now seems that a deal has been agreed and the player will look to complete a medical this weekend, before facing a work permit hearing next week.
